    OTT television signals are received over the Internet or through a cell phone network, as opposed to receiving television signals from terrestrial broadcasters, cable networks, or via satellite transmission. The video distributor controls access through an app, a separate OTT dongle, or a box connected to a phone, PC, or smart television set ...

    The Roku Channel is an over-the-top video streaming service available in the U.S., Canada, Mexico and the U.K. The service was launched in 2017, and is owned and operated by Roku, Inc. [1] [2] It is the most popular free ad-supported streaming television (FAST) service in the U.S., [3] [4] reportedly reaching 145 million people, as of 2024. [5]
